From 024aa1848500904e39bc582475bc96b52658a00f Mon Sep 17 00:00:00 2001 From: John Cleaver Date: Mon, 26 Feb 2018 21:45:47 -0500 Subject: [PATCH] Add base components --- package.json | 1 + src/App.vue | 22 ++++++--------- src/components/AppFooter.vue | 53 ++++++++++++++++++++++++++++++++++++ src/components/HeaderBar.vue | 45 ++++++++++++++++++++++++++++++ src/components/Welcome.vue | 21 ++++++++++++++ src/router/index.js | 9 +++--- yarn.lock | 6 ++++ 7 files changed, 140 insertions(+), 17 deletions(-) create mode 100644 src/components/AppFooter.vue create mode 100644 src/components/HeaderBar.vue create mode 100644 src/components/Welcome.vue diff --git a/package.json b/package.json index 9d64e18..4ab95ee 100644 --- a/package.json +++ b/package.json @@ -12,6 +12,7 @@ }, "dependencies": { "@fortawesome/fontawesome": "^1.1.4", + "@fortawesome/fontawesome-free-brands": "^5.0.7", "@fortawesome/fontawesome-free-solid": "^5.0.7", "@fortawesome/vue-fontawesome": "^0.0.22", "bulma": "^0.6.2", diff --git a/src/App.vue b/src/App.vue index d74c648..5361a20 100644 --- a/src/App.vue +++ b/src/App.vue @@ -1,23 +1,19 @@ - - diff --git a/src/components/AppFooter.vue b/src/components/AppFooter.vue new file mode 100644 index 0000000..56b0535 --- /dev/null +++ b/src/components/AppFooter.vue @@ -0,0 +1,53 @@ + + + + + diff --git a/src/components/HeaderBar.vue b/src/components/HeaderBar.vue new file mode 100644 index 0000000..b8eb023 --- /dev/null +++ b/src/components/HeaderBar.vue @@ -0,0 +1,45 @@ + + + + + diff --git a/src/components/Welcome.vue b/src/components/Welcome.vue new file mode 100644 index 0000000..68d5346 --- /dev/null +++ b/src/components/Welcome.vue @@ -0,0 +1,21 @@ + + + + + diff --git a/src/router/index.js b/src/router/index.js index 5fa7f9d..ad862a7 100644 --- a/src/router/index.js +++ b/src/router/index.js @@ -1,6 +1,6 @@ import Vue from 'vue' import Router from 'vue-router' -import HelloWorld from '@/components/HelloWorld' +import Welcome from '@/components/Welcome' Vue.use(Router) @@ -8,8 +8,9 @@ export default new Router({ routes: [ { path: '/', - name: 'HelloWorld', - component: HelloWorld + name: 'Welcome', + component: Welcome } - ] + ], + linkExactActiveClass: 'is-active' }) diff --git a/yarn.lock b/yarn.lock index 7233dd5..f38f467 100644 --- a/yarn.lock +++ b/yarn.lock @@ -75,6 +75,12 @@ version "0.1.3" resolved "https://registry.yarnpkg.com/@fortawesome/fontawesome-common-types/-/fontawesome-common-types-0.1.3.tgz#8475e0f2d1ad1f858c4ec2e76ed9a2456a09ad83" +"@fortawesome/fontawesome-free-brands@^5.0.7": + version "5.0.7" + resolved "https://registry.yarnpkg.com/@fortawesome/fontawesome-free-brands/-/fontawesome-free-brands-5.0.7.tgz#0fe131da1bfb7f5f49b7b800b9e198e530fab418" + dependencies: + "@fortawesome/fontawesome-common-types" "^0.1.3" + "@fortawesome/fontawesome-free-solid@^5.0.7": version "5.0.7" resolved "https://registry.yarnpkg.com/@fortawesome/fontawesome-free-solid/-/fontawesome-free-solid-5.0.7.tgz#b7e68876a24b3a0a34c09ee68bd57fe63925a578"